## Authentication

Gridforge export workers stream spreadsheet rows to keep memory flat; expect ~200MB per worker regardless of sheet size. If memory climbs past that, check for disabled streaming in the release config. All export telemetry is pulled from the internal Meterline service, which requires authentication on every call. Staging and production use separate credentials. Do not reuse keys across environments, and rotate after each release cut. The key for the current release cycle is below.

app token of bahaf-tajeg = zpat23_SjjsllwiLmXbtS65veZaV47

The REGION and BUFFER_LINES
# values rarely change; leave them alone unless the ingest
# cluster moves. Rotation of the stream token happens quarterly
# and is handled by the ops rotation script, not by hand.
# If tailing silently returns nothing, the token below has
# probably expired. The current stream token is set on the
# following line.
# ---------------------------------------------------------------

vault entry, yahaf-tagug: LEDGER_TOKEN20=884d77d1a8b98aa4edfb

Finance Review Summary — Reseller Programme

Quick read on the Brightloom reseller scheme: 42 active partners, up from 28 last quarter. Partner-sourced revenue now sits at 18% of total, though average deal size dipped slightly. Rebate accruals are tracking on budget. We'll tighten tier thresholds in Q4. For context, the confidential planning note below explains where we want this to land.

board note of bawep-tajef: Queniusek Systems plans to raise the Quenvan list price by 53.1 percent in March. The pricing group signed off on a budget of $176.4 million for Project Drueth. The renewal with Casionix Partners closes at $142.5 million a year, 8.3 percent below the last contract. Project Fraax slips by six weeks because of the tooling delay.

The adjustment reflects slower sell-through and a conservative revaluation of returned goods. Operating covenants remain comfortably within limits, and auditors have reviewed our methodology without objection. We will present remediation steps, including revised ordering thresholds, at the January session. The implications for next year's range strategy are set out confidentially below.

management briefing: Project Ulavan slips by two quarters because of the staffing delay.